About

With the help of an online community, a nerdy and socially awkward man gathers the courage to start dating an attractive lady he met on a train.

Episodes

Season 1

See all 11episodes →
E1

A Love Being Watched Over by a Million People

Jul 7, 200550m8.0

Yamada Tsuyoshi is a middle class otaku (Japanese geek) who one day defends Aoyama Saori from a drunkard on the train.

E2

I'm Off to My First Date; Big Transformation

Jul 14, 200550m8.0

Yamada manages to finally reach Saori, inviting her to dinner. Following the advice from 2channel users, Yamada changes his appearance to impress Saori.

E3

Huge First Date Crisis!!

Jul 21, 200550m8.0

Yamada feels the first date was a disaster; Saori calls and asks if he would like to meet up again. This time, however, Saori brings a friend along.

E4

Summer! Big Surfing Crash Course

Jul 28, 200550m8.0

After Saori mistakes "surfing the web" for surfing, Yamada has to quickly learn how to surf to impress her.

E5

Big Anti-stalker Strategy

Aug 4, 200550m8.0

A mysterious stalker starts harassing Saori. Yamada investigates to find out who the stalker is.

E6

A (Love) Confession is the Beginning of All Your Troubles!

Aug 11, 200550m8.0

Yamada is invited to Saori's house for the first time for tea. Although he tries to tell Saori he likes her, he is unable to muster the courage. A second date is arranged and Yamada lies to Saori that he can't make it due to work but is actually going to a manga convention.

E7

Getting Rid of my Nerdiness!! Birthday of Tears

Aug 18, 200550m8.0

Yamada believes that Saori is disappointed in discovering his "otaku" nature. He decides to give up all his figurines and "otaku" collection. Saori, however, is only saddened because Yamada had lied to her.

E8

Revived!! Breaking Otaku's Tears

Aug 25, 200550m8.0

Yamada is finally able to show Saori his "otaku" nature even with the fear of rejection.

Train Man Cast and Characters

The cast features Atsushi Ito (as Tsuyoshi Yamada ("Train Man"/ "Densha Otoko")), Misaki Itō (as Saori Aoyama ("Hermes")), Miho Shiraishi (as Kisuzu Jinkama), Mokomichi Hayami (as Keisuke Aoyama), and Eriko Sato (as Kaho Sawazaki).
